automobile club travel counselor

A professional who plans trips for members of automobile club. Respnsibilities include:

  • Confers with member in person or by telephone to answer questions and explain services.
  • Marks suitable roads and possible detours on road map, showing route from point of origin to destination and return.
  • Indicates points of interest, restaurants, hotels or other housing accommodations, and emergency repair services available along route.
  • Reserves hotel, motel, or resort accommodations by telephone, telegraph, or letter.
  • Calculates mileage of marked route and estimates travel expenses.
  • Informs patron of bus, ship, train, and plane connections.
  • Consults hotel directories, road maps, circulars, timetables, and other sources to obtain current information.
  • Provides members with guides, directories, brochures and maps.
  • May plan trips for members in response to mail requests.
  • May plan foreign trips and perform duties, such as arranging for automobile rental, purchase, and shipment, and be designated World-Travel Counselor.
  • May review itineraries prepared by other travel counselors for factors such as accuracy, pricing, and date and timetable sequencing and be designated Travel-Ticketing Reviewer.
